Transaction 17907265cc8b1cb36d495a518512889ed0c0516b2576d12acf489d85bd48833b
1 Input
1 Output
-
17907265cc8b1cb36d495a518512889ed0c0516b2576d12acf489d85bd48833b:0
- value
- 26210545
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7316b5694fa0c554ef8e30c26c0e1fda5b42bb8b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BVXutHvDm5NvqQnLwzKvjy1oFt9N2FiC5